Almaden Valley Women’s Club Offering College Scholarships to Graduating Seniors

logo: Almaden Valley Women's ClubAlmaden Valley Women’s Club (AVWC) is once again offering college scholarships to graduating seniors who live in Almaden Valley.

These scholarships, funded through the Almaden Valley Art & Wine Festival, promote student service and academic achievement, and recognize high school students for outstanding leadership in service within our community.

AVWC has several scholarships to award to deserving students this year. Individual scholarships range from $500 – $2500.

Winners will be selected based on outstanding volunteer experience, academic performance, school activities, letters of recommendation, and personal essay.

Application and supporting documents must be returned by April 9, 2011. Check the Almaden Valley Women’s Club website for pre-requisites and the application packet.

Internet Safety Seminar for Parents in Almaden Valley

logo: Common Sense MediaCommon Sense Media is providing an Internet Safety Seminar in Almaden Valley. This seminar will address issues such as cyberbullying, texting, and social networking. The event is for parents only.

The Internet is social for preteens and teens. Kids at this age still need parental guidance on how to conduct themselves online. You will learn how to help your child become responsible digital citizens, which will ultimately keep them safe online.

Common Sense Media is a non-partisan, non-profit organization that provides trustworthy information and tools, as well as an independent forum, so that families have a choice and a voice about the media they consume.

The seminar is at Bret Harte Middle School in Almaden Valley on March 16, 2011, from 7-8pm. Mark your calendars!

Registration Now Open for 10th Annual / 2011 Math Enrichment Summer Program at Leland High School

logo: Math Enrichment ProgramRegistration is now open for the 10th Annual / 2011 Math Enrichment Summer Program at Leland High School in Almaden Valley.

Math Enrichment is an independent Summer program for students going into Kindergarten through 11th Grade.

The program provides a superior Summer educational experience in a diverse, family-oriented environment, and meets all the academic, social, creative, emotional, and physical needs of the individual student. The academic curriculum is focused on reading, writing, and mathematics.

Math Enrichment’s staff is comprised of California Credentialed teachers from various school districts throughout the Santa Clara County, and is fully accredited by the Schools Commission of the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C).

Math Enrichment is at Leland High School in Almaden Valley. Classes begin June 13, 2011 and end July 22, 2011. Class is held Monday through Friday, 9:00am to 3:00pm. Before and after school care is provided.

Simonds Elementary’s 2011 Annual Science Fair at Almaden Community Center

Simonds Elementary School is hosting its 8th Annual / 2011 Science Fair. The fair provides an opportunity for all students to have fun with science, and to learn about the principles of logic and scientific deduction.

The fair is open to other students, parents, friends, family, and the general public. Come see the students present their exhibits, and see what they’ve learned in their various science classes. 1st, 2nd, and 3rd place prizes will be awarded for grades 2-5.

Students in kindergarten through second grade will display their projects at the Simonds Cafeteria on February 8, 2011 from 6:30 to 7:30pm. Students in grades 3-5 will present their projects at the Almaden Community Center on February 9, 2011 from 7:00 to 8:00pm.

SeniorNet Learning Center of Almaden – Winter 2011 Registration and Courses

logo: SeniorNet Learning Center of Almaden ValleySeniorNet Learning Center of Almaden has released its Winter 2011 Course Schedule.

Choose from a number of different computer, Internet, and software application courses, including an Introduction to Google and Introduction to Facebook. Download the Winter 2011 Session Brochure.

Registration for the Winter 2011 Session is at the Almaden Community Center on Saturday, January 8, 2011, at 11:30am. Classes are also at the Almaden Community Center, and begin January 10, 2011 and end March 7, 2011. (Most of the courses are one day a week for two hours, and last from four to eight weeks.)

The price for an annual membership to SeniorNet is $40. The annual renewal fee for existing members is $30. Individual courses range from $10 to $20 each.
